A blockbuster heavyweight boxing clash between Anthony Joshua and Tyson Fury is reportedly moving closer to reality, with both fighters agreeing in principle to a fight that could be streamed exclusively on Netflix. The matchup has been anticipated for years and would feature two of Britain’s most celebrated boxers facing off in the ring.
The fight comes as Fury prepares for a comeback this year, and his ongoing collaboration with Netflix suggests the platform is keen to host one of boxing’s most high-profile events. If finalised, the bout would rank among the most commercially significant heavyweight fights in recent memory.
Both fighters’ teams are said to be working through details such as scheduling, promotion, and streaming rights, though an official date and venue have yet to be announced. Negotiations remain ongoing as hype continues to build for the clash.
If confirmed, the fight would bring together two of the dominant figures of boxing’s current heavyweight era, offering fans worldwide a major sporting spectacle on a global streaming platform.
